How to define the work

Describe the problem: an extra sleeping room, less crowded common space, better access, or a separate work area. Rank privacy, storage, circulation, and daylight. Separate needs from a preferred design so a different solution can be considered. Include household changes you expect rather than sizing only for today.

The first review confirms project fit. Design, engineering, specialist assessments, permits, material selections, and construction responsibilities should be identified in the proposed scope. Availability and a final price require review of the actual property.
